Religion in Narrandera

What people believe — religious affiliation and those with no religion.

More than half of the people in Narrandera identify as Christians, making it the most common faith here. This strong religious presence is reflected in the fact that far fewer people claim no religion compared to most other Australian areas.

Religious affiliation

The mix of religions, and people with no religion.

Christianity is the main faith at 57.4%, while 31.2% of residents have no religion. This last figure is much lower than in most similar areas and sits well below the national figure of 38.9%.

31.2% ▲ +125.4%

Lower than 75% of suburb / locality areas.

  • 2011: 13.8%
  • 2016: 20.6%
  • 2021: 31.2%

Share of people reporting no religion (incl. secular and other spiritual beliefs).
